1. Define the scope and objectives of your research project. 2. Use Perplexity to gather relevant sources, employing task codes to streamline searches. 3. Filter sources and import key materials into NotebookLM. 4. Ask targeted questions in NotebookLM to extract insights and patterns. 5. Synthesize findings to inform decision-making or content creation.

1. Use Perplexity to search and collect sources: - Create a Perplexity Space named '[PROJECT_NAME]' - [TASK_CODE_1] for [SPECIFIC_INFO_1] - [TASK_CODE_2] for [SPECIFIC_INFO_2] 2. Validate and import valuable source links into NotebookLM. 3. In NotebookLM, ask: 'What are major shifts or patterns in [TOPIC]?' and 'What drives [STUDY_SUBJECT]?' 4. Synthesize insights and generate actionable insights.
